Submitted by Pauline Rute Hall 1952 <Grammypgh@aol.com> on 28/Jul/2015 Message: Marguerite "Peg" Harris McDermott, of the Town of Newburgh, entered into rest Monday, July 27, 2015 at St. Luke's Cornwall Hospital-Newburgh Campus. She was 98 years old. The daughter of the late Clinton and Ruth Klyne Harris, Marguerite was born June 29, 1917 in the Town of Newburgh. Marguerite was active in 4H growing up, and won many awards at the county and state level. She was lifelong member of the Gardnertown United Methodist Church. Peg graduated from Newburgh Free Academy and St. Luke's Hospital School of Nursing and was valedictorian of her class. She worked many years as an OB/GYN nurse at St. Luke's Hospital and was a member of American Legion Auxiliary Post 1420. She was well known in antique and collecting circles for collecting Heisey glassware and local history memorabilia. Family was the center of Mom's and Dad's world. Mom enjoyed cooking, baking and sewing for family and for church fairs and PTA fundraisers. She was a Girl Scout leader for her girls and the girls of Orange Lake. Mom welcomed her sons-in-law into the family as if they were her own sons. When she was blessed with grandchildren, they became her treasures as well. She kept track of each of them and loved having all of them all together at Cape May or camping. Each great grandchild was an added blessing to her already full treasure trove. Survivors include her children, Beverly Mennerich and husband, Ken of the Town of Newburgh, Eileen Paul and husband, Ben of Seattle, WA and Barbara Johnson, and husband, Ed of New Windsor; grandchildren, Brian Mennerich and wife, Dana, Carrie Burns and husband, Tom, Kelly Johnson, Keith Johnson and wife, Desiree, Justin Paul and wife, Emily, Jared Paul; and great grandchildren, Thomas, James, Andrew Burns, Branden, Emily Johnson, Kaci Kuhn and Felicity Paul; sister, Evelyn Anderson; as well as nieces, nephews and cousins. Marguerite was predeceased in 2002 by her husband, Frank C. McDermott, whom she married on September 21, 1940; and by her siblings, Bernice Harris and Robert Harris.
